Chheriha Population - Deoria, Uttar Pradesh

Chheriha is a large village located in Bhatpar Rani Tehsil of Deoria district, Uttar Pradesh with total 374 families residing. The Chheriha village has population of 2845 of which 1446 are males while 1399 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Chheriha village population of children with age 0-6 is 462 which makes up 16.24 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chheriha village is 967 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Chheriha as per census is 848,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Chheriha village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Chheriha village was 73.56 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Chheriha Male literacy stands at 86.29 % while female literacy rate was 60.74 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 22.64 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 14.27 % of total population in Chheriha village.

Work Profile

In Chheriha village out of total population, 1169 were engaged in work activities. 9.32 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 90.68 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1169 workers engaged in Main Work, 22 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 36 were Agricultural labourer.
